掌握两种编程语言是一个逐步积累的过程,以下是一些建议:
选择互补的编程语言
选择两种不同的编程语言,而不是相似的语言,可以帮助你了解不同的编程范式和思维方式。例如,Python适合快速原型开发,而C++适合高性能计算。
制定学习计划
根据自己的需求和兴趣,制定一个合理的学习计划,平衡两种语言的学习时间。可以选择一些优秀的教程和资源来辅助学习。
实践是关键
通过实际项目和练习来掌握编程语言的特性和用法。可以尝试用两种语言来解决同一个问题,比较它们的优缺点和效率。同时,参与开源项目或者自己开发一些小项目也是非常有帮助的。
持续学习和保持更新
编程语言发展迅速,新的语言和工具不断涌现。要保持学习的热情和持续学习的习惯,可以通过参加编程社区的讨论、阅读技术博客和参加技术研讨会来保持与最新技术的接触。
灵活切换思维模式
学会几个基本句式并不难,重点是要培养“语言思维”,也就是换一种语言解决问题的时候,你要快速适应它。这就好比说意大利语里形容词放后面,英语里又放前面,一样的道理,编程语言也各有“语法癖好”。
利用现有知识和资源
如果你已经会了一种编程语言,那么学习第二种语言时,可以将其作为参考。例如,如果你已经熟悉了JavaScript,学习Python时,可以对比两者的语法和常见用法。
参与社区和讨论
加入编程社区,参与讨论,可以帮助你解决问题,同时也能了解其他开发者的经验和心得。
注重实际应用
尽量在实际项目中使用学到的编程语言,这样可以加深理解和记忆。例如,在Web开发中,可以用JavaScript进行前端开发,用Python进行后端开发。
避免混淆
学习多种编程语言时,要注意避免混淆。可以通过为不同的语言设置不同的开发环境、使用不同的命名规范等方式来区分它们。
保持耐心和毅力
掌握两种编程语言需要时间和努力,不要期望一蹴而就。保持耐心,持续学习和实践,最终你会发现自己能够熟练运用这两种语言。
通过以上步骤,你可以逐步掌握两种编程语言,并在实际开发中灵活运用它们。